Claude Code S | Cursor S | Copy.ai A | Granola S |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Tagline | Anthropic's CLI agent. Opus-powered, operates on your repo directly. | VS Code fork that made AI coding actually work. | AI GTM platform. Workflows for sales + marketing ops. | Meeting notes that don't suck. Runs locally, no bot joins. |
| Category | coding | coding | marketing | meeting |
| Pricing | Part of Claude Pro/Max/Team plans | Free + $20/mo Pro + $40/mo Business | Free + $49-$249/mo | Free + $18/mo |
| Best for | Developers who want an agent, not autocomplete. Large refactors, tests, docs. | Developers. Non-developers who want to ship working code. | RevOps + marketing ops automating repetitive tasks. | Founders, execs, consultants who live in calls. |
